How to Convert Digit to Link (Gunter's)
Converting Digit to Link (Gunter's) involves multiplying the value by a specific conversion factor, as shown in the formula below.
Formula:
1 Digit = 0.094697 links
Example Calculation:
Convert 10 digits: 10 × 0.094697 = 0.94697 links

What is a Digit and a Link (Gunter's)?
The Digit, also known as the finger or fingerbreadth, is an ancient, anthropomorphic unit of length, originally based on the breadth (width) of a human adult finger (typically the index finger). As a body-based unit, its value varied significantly depending on the person, time period, and culture.
Historically, it was often considered to be approximately 3/4 of an inch or about 1.9 centimeters (cm). In many systems, it formed a subdivision of larger units like the palm, span, or cubit. For example, it was common for:
- 4 digits = 1 palm
- 12 digits = 1 span (sometimes)
- 24 or 28 digits = 1 cubit (depending on the cubit definition)
The Link, specifically Gunter's Link (symbol li), is a unit of length historically used in surveying, particularly within the imperial and U.S. customary systems. It is defined as exactly 1/100th of a Gunter's chain.
One Gunter's link is equivalent to:
- 0.01 Gunter's chains
- 7.92 inches (in)
- 0.66 feet (ft) (exactly 2/3 of a foot)
- 0.22 yards (yd)
- 0.04 rods (also called poles or perches)
- 0.201168 meters (m) (exactly)
- 20.1168 centimeters (cm)
A Gunter's chain itself measures 66 feet, 22 yards, 4 rods, or 20.1168 meters.

History of the Digit and Link (Gunter's)
The digit is one of the oldest known units of measurement, used by ancient civilizations including the Egyptians, Mesopotamians, Greeks, Romans, and later across Europe. Its convenience stemmed from the ready availability of the human hand for estimation.
- Ancient Egypt: The digit (djeba) was a fundamental unit, with 28 digits forming the Royal Cubit.
- Ancient Rome: The Roman digit (digitus) was defined as 1/16 of a Roman foot, approximately 1.85 cm. Four digiti made a palmus (palm).
- Medieval England: The digit was often reckoned as 3/4 of an inch, derived from the barleycorn (3 barleycorns = 1 inch, 4 digits = 3 inches).
Due to its inherent variability and the rise of more standardized systems based on physical prototypes (like the yard or meter), the digit gradually fell out of practical use for trade and science, becoming largely obsolete by the early modern period.
The link, as part of Gunter's chain, was devised by the English clergyman and mathematician Edmund Gunter around 1620. He introduced a measuring chain that was 66 feet long and divided into 100 links. This system was revolutionary for surveyors because its decimal nature (100 links per chain) simplified calculations, especially for area. Land area could be easily calculated in square chains and then converted to acres, as 10 square chains equal exactly 1 acre. Gunter's chain and its links became the standard tools for land surveying in England and later throughout the British Empire and the United States for centuries.

Common Uses for digits
The digit is now obsolete for practical measurement but is encountered in:
- Historical Texts: Found in ancient and medieval documents describing dimensions of objects, buildings, or anatomical measurements.
- Archaeology & Anthropology: Used when interpreting historical measurements or comparing ancient systems.
- Figurative Language: Occasionally used informally to mean a very small distance ("just a digit more").
- Understanding Historical Units: Key to understanding the structure of ancient measurement systems (e.g., relationship to palm, cubit).
Common Uses for links
The Gunter's link is now largely obsolete but was historically significant:
- Land Surveying: It was the fundamental unit for measuring property boundaries and land parcels in English-speaking countries for over 300 years.
- Cartography: Used in creating maps and plats based on surveys.
- Land Records: Measurements in links (and chains) frequently appear in older property deeds, historical surveys, and legal descriptions of land. Understanding the link is crucial for interpreting these documents.
- Agriculture: The system was tied to the definition of the acre, a common unit of land area.
Its use declined dramatically with the adoption of the metric system and the advent of more precise surveying technologies like steel tapes, theodolites, Electronic Distance Measurement (EDM), and GPS.

How long is a digit?
There is no single, precise value for the digit because it was based on human anatomy and varied by system. Common historical approximations include:
- Approximately 0.75 inches (in)
- Approximately 1.85 to 1.9 centimeters (cm)
- Often defined as 1/4 of a palm or 1/16 of a foot within specific historical systems.
What is the relation between a digit and a palm?
In many historical systems (like the Roman and often the English), 4 digits were considered equal to 1 palm (the width of the hand across the base of the fingers).
What is the relation between a digit and a cubit?
The relationship varied. For example:
- The Egyptian Royal Cubit contained 28 digits.
- The common Greek and Roman cubits often contained 24 digits.
Is the digit an SI unit?
No, the digit is not an SI unit. It is an ancient, non-standardized, anthropomorphic unit. The corresponding SI unit for length is the meter (m).
Is the digit still used today?
No, the digit is not used for any standard or practical measurements today. Its use is confined to historical study, interpretation of old texts, and occasional figurative speech.
Where does the name 'digit' come from?
The name comes from the Latin word digitus, which means "finger" or "toe". This reflects the unit's origin based on the width of a human finger.
About Link (Gunter's) (li)
How long is a Gunter's Link?
One Gunter's Link is equal to:
- 7.92 inches
- 0.66 feet (2/3 ft)
- 0.201168 meters
- 20.1168 centimeters
How many links are in a Gunter's chain?
There are exactly 100 links in one Gunter's chain.
How long is a Gunter's Chain?
One Gunter's chain is equal to:
- 100 links
- 66 feet
- 22 yards
- 4 rods (or poles, perches)
- 1/10th of a furlong
- 1/80th of a statute mile
- 20.1168 meters
How does the link relate to the acre?
The link is directly related to the acre through the Gunter's chain. An acre is defined as 10 square chains. Since 1 chain = 100 links:
- 1 acre = 10 × (100 links)² = 10 × 10,000 square links = 100,000 square links. This decimal relationship greatly simplified area calculations for surveyors using the chain.
Is the link an SI unit?
No, the Gunter's link is not an SI unit. It is part of the traditional imperial and U.S. customary systems. The corresponding SI unit for length is the meter (m).
Is the Gunter's link still used today?
No, the Gunter's link is rarely used in modern surveying practice. Its primary relevance today is in historical contexts, particularly when interpreting old land deeds, surveys, and maps created using Gunter's system. Modern surveying relies on meters or feet, measured with advanced electronic equipment.
Why was it called a 'link'?
It was called a 'link' because Gunter's chain was literally constructed from 100 physical metal links connected by rings. Each link served as a unit of measurement.
